ANUROOP 2025 Cultural Event
Malwanchal University in Indore hosted the ANUROOP 2025 cultural event, a vibrant celebration of dance, singing, fashion, and skit. The event was organized across various departments, with the Index Department of Physiotherapy and Paramedical Sciences hosting the dance competition.
Dance Competition : The dance competition was held in solo, duet, and group categories, showcasing the talents of students from the Index Department of Physiotherapy and Paramedical Sciences. The winners were:
